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/block-core/blockcore-wallet

Web5 Wallet for your coins, tokens, identities, NFTs and more.
https://github.com/block-core/blockcore-wallet

Fix problem with subscriptions array

93335a91be3233a3576862b112ba657c0fcad8f1 authored almost 3 years ago
Improve the account view when changing accounts from menu

9ba69f8d35de0d9805454866eda2bdeab9267fc2 authored almost 3 years ago
Load existing state before redirect to home

495828b7b59b590a56c8db46cdbe73834d19a690 authored almost 3 years ago
Hide the purpose and network hide from account edit

- Replace the network ID with the user friendly network name.

66ae1e96300b3f44b2de6854e9aa76cdeb501fe7 authored almost 3 years ago
Cleanup old horrible popup logic

5fc4620dc83afcc163a380db556df034e4dfe097 authored almost 3 years ago
Make the popup add proper CSS

932d6b8e9a4722252e6ee0018fcd9c179913c0ee authored almost 3 years ago
Fix issue after account creation

- Redirect properly after account has been created.
- Display only the account index on the "acc...

0ed8b1176310d8b640e44a9d969ccf43f1d95fad authored almost 3 years ago
Fix issue with removing a wallet

d2c02b7e618d21e302bb997581434d1d61eeba99 authored almost 3 years ago
Fix the issue where account remove did not redirect after refactoring

63326301ab059d8a79abcf6b4f754e3f3758e9d5 authored almost 3 years ago
Don't hide the account menu when selectin a different account

- Some additional styling improvements.

622f0c0a3ee99d2df2cf34604b3ef33a1fe0c44a authored almost 3 years ago
Fix loading of language from settings

1fc48dc4ffff2d55462c2ae4f574f1ce4a487d5b authored almost 3 years ago
Organize settings in more logical order

- Fixes issue where state was not saved when changing the wallet.

06ab3df835d80b7545e6faa6a909237c5fecb22c authored almost 3 years ago
Select the previous default wallet when none is selected (occurs on startup)

64899321f7e40f51c7ccfc5127d6971ca1a93235 authored almost 3 years ago
Use routing to change active wallet

- Make the menu options work with keyboard navigation.

05cac8edae78de8c0f5401a50a00c2851ed235ab authored almost 3 years ago
Improve the main menu layout

- Make the wallet and extension behave and look similar.

5e5293dba232f205c0307916b4e65ac812b5ed59 authored almost 3 years ago
Fix initial wallet and account creation

0b36e263c41f89bfdad7356a919b58670c0dc708 authored almost 3 years ago
Update all code with simplifies imports based upon the barrel file for services

afd932f4405968a5d8d786dc9ac7d8da095761a8 authored almost 3 years ago
Fix circular dependency

31ea64a24e4c382ef139c25b1ebee1506a3364ae authored almost 3 years ago
Final refactoring that makes code build

1e063432fcfa15eb4ed6d559ca56c782b624a04a authored almost 3 years ago
Add a barrel file for services

- The collection of services has grown a lot, added a barrel file to simplify imports throughout...

f98e3fe92938a45c66254e45aa09777727e726ad authored almost 3 years ago
WIP: More refactoring of the recent changes

8943ceee715c9165823fcc7f176063bf17f948cd authored almost 3 years ago
WIP: More cleanup after moving services

964c13bdccfb3f898f52c232e6d1ef72a3e1aaf7 authored almost 3 years ago
WIP: Refactoring all the background services into services

3f17a5bbc7bd0d78807775be90daffdcb73a5a6e authored almost 3 years ago
WIP: Starts migrating away from having the active wallet ID on UIState

- Need to commit this because all the services in "background" folder must be moved.

462a8bcd740f49890c19dff030a683d2ac7d1a29 authored almost 3 years ago
Fix issue with copy debug and error logs to clipboard

41287abdfe9cd56f66b8c5f7b3c0142e7cbc61c0 authored almost 3 years ago
Fixes a hard to find problem with the initial network status array

3080e589ed329b97be0c0236c5f62f9e59ae5792 authored almost 3 years ago
Add a generic state service and migrate network status manager to service

3348808482321b441f46e9e3555516a2ce3ed3c4 authored almost 3 years ago
Minor fix for lock of wallet

- Send user back to unlock when locking from the main menu.

d2d1d5385dbcd47cd916ff6c2e8e31a20580a5b6 authored almost 3 years ago
Fix account rename feature

8b5caaf7b05bfd8c3a07fee701d3e4f478ab40a7 authored almost 3 years ago
Completes the SettingsService refactoring

4406c04ace068ee6d609eb68f1066d641a1a7174 authored almost 3 years ago
WIP: Refactoring away from settings on the persisted state to SettingsService

ec53c72abc1574ec822fb85897b0ea4b290aa63e authored almost 3 years ago
Fix password change feature

19f7089835fc38ec6d5c648e0bb22c502397877c authored almost 3 years ago
Fix default UI state data

- Fixes issues with wipe of all data where default UI state data was not set to anything.

a77e1efcd71742c2bb9d500c22bcd98aceb9e3ab authored almost 3 years ago
Move all loading to loading component

- There was a race-condition when perform async awaits in the ngOnInit in AppComponent and the L...

77a9a1731d295ed084634b1e5d98a45d6d8f2d89 authored almost 3 years ago
Remove unused code

15aea85b6c196dd131dbd4fc85ee29e9839f0398 authored almost 3 years ago
Fix the wallet remove functionality

dcf281d189f161e09856cf64ece3b34479867b0c authored almost 3 years ago
Reveal secret recovery phrase migrated to new architecture

2953ec8c3aac7b30ffc1df8538a4e44118ae49f5 authored almost 3 years ago
Migrate the wallet change password functionality

4ae239b3db8a6dfaa9bd4b3d2559a02a1b0d54b5 authored almost 3 years ago
Fix account creation and unlock to display dashboard

6b5cce93ac891589618be7a28ac71b8bef083396 authored almost 3 years ago
Fix the wallet unlock functionality

24d9aa5ee32836581122ce27219370603009a4d4 authored almost 3 years ago
Wallet create and load lock screen complete

b191d7920c3f2ea623e4f7fc8c15a48954c182c8 authored almost 3 years ago
Migrate logic from background to services

b598085929c529a773067195df62ca76033e9dee authored almost 3 years ago
Update active time when saving a secret

- Only delete the "keys" on timeout and not the entire session store.

004867b328b9866305413de04795f6406058d694 authored almost 3 years ago
Working and functional SecureStateService

- WIP: Some test buttons, etc. in this commit.

0f449c2916f0bf51895800c69c3245c0fae391a8 authored almost 3 years ago
Merge branch 'main' of https://github.com/block-core/blockcore-extension

08e0938027d7c3b0d9496d9621ead5d36eee6aa3 authored almost 3 years ago
Fix label casing on account and network status (#71)

1ebf791935683acbfe05939885442d3c15db092e authored almost 3 years ago
WIP: Lots more work needed for serialization of the secure state

86d1fb6398f3fc86bb1d79bd68fe63f2fae370ef authored almost 3 years ago
Add settings service and secure state service

d5646b899cc409c978634dac5e1e310163ca4fc8 authored almost 3 years ago
Introduce EventBus

- WIP: This will replace the existing CommunicationBackgroundService/CommunicationService.

efbe1b0a43b39ea0a2e0396f1c5c3038fbd8da9d authored almost 3 years ago
Fix circular dependency graph

b63abdb199969f92007d27d3552caee952c08b41 authored almost 3 years ago
Migrate away from direct dependency on environment files

36fb06fa62902fb8dd3d43e17b867bd89f5249e2 authored almost 3 years ago
Update dependency on secp256k1 package

67d8864d0762ae717ceec66c6e855b1e2a896147 authored almost 3 years ago
Feature/manifestv3 (#75)

* Initial migration from Manifest V2 to V3

* Cleanup of webpack

- Reload is handled differ...

f229074cb093828f11dd8a9fdbab3e849f8e8e7e authored almost 3 years ago
Minor TODO task added

409630e5ab344947b1ce4d13c194f900511ff6d0 authored almost 3 years ago
WIP: Add action handler for "nostr" (web+nostrid)

- There are no specification or standard for this type of authentication yet, added for future i...

6e7d55192f679100d3e7d9d8eb1012b9cf0cd224 authored almost 3 years ago
Improving the orchestration of Stratis ID signing action

48a0972821f59858154c45e24167099d67e0c7a7 authored almost 3 years ago
Completes a working prototype for Stratis Identity login

572e01a31e33a8997d9ac41be26032c878918e35 authored almost 3 years ago
Improve the Stratis Identity (SID) action

- The SID action was improved and made similar to Stratis Wallet (mobile app).

7f036954d9ec3d28b93ee82b94838689373689ef authored almost 3 years ago
Add handling of slow loading (failure to load state)

6dfe3e68ee2f4b7453a964785b584effcfa9ec4a authored almost 3 years ago
"sid" is not an approved prefix

d425dff93ec2cc595ab383f42dd51d3e8eaf5ece authored almost 3 years ago
Configure the handler and query parameter

205ebbb3e645a399bf621ce619c6be64b68df5f8 authored almost 3 years ago
Add FeatureService to handler

d429299c0744c870dde4d1f9c32f17601993072f authored almost 3 years ago
Add support for groups on feature toggling

- Starts adding separation of which protocol handlers the different extension instances will sup...

51e9fbb7dd91082983d2d496379745ceb93dfe28 authored almost 3 years ago
Add protocol handler UX

- Add the option to add different protocols that the extension should handle.
- Adds "declarativ...

a315d367e8e437a90d972d4c611c0767b3f40d9f authored almost 3 years ago
WIP: Replicate existing data structure

- The same structure as before is built, but with different iteration logic.

341aea9f1d03189218c2ccd32e2a195bccf72d20 authored almost 3 years ago
WIP: Refactoring logic to retrieve wallet data

82a6595cd91d8bc43199bf3dae79127afb3eb599 authored almost 3 years ago
Calculate confirmation on transactions

- Confirmations that are show in the history and on transaction details is calculated off the la...

322989db127ec71bfc649ce171ea509d573fe567 authored almost 3 years ago
Improve back routing after sending transaction

- This includes a WIP for transaction history. It will currently list all history, not filtered ...

3e4543f3ebc7eedcbd6c3ba796edaa8e7722eb3a authored almost 3 years ago
Make the network card a reusable component

0f509ca5fd839c49f6f398bbb38f80218f4e0a3f authored almost 3 years ago
Add display of detailed network status on account view

- Closes #68

8bd2d52bfad57e26be61ec2f0c32e38ad035edf5 authored almost 3 years ago
Fix issue with selecting the same account twice

- Always trigger the account changed event.

8e06e36bf6e574b778758cf1b4628793268bd7f4 authored almost 3 years ago
Minor typo on default account view

- Related to #60

a84d2b29bbba67f5afddba1d32dffdd9fbd4092e authored almost 3 years ago
Fix issue with title ("Unlock Wallet")

- Closes #63

33ad27972bfb3cdd0a3ccb5a229480b284fccaaf authored almost 3 years ago
Migrate to use identifier for accounts as oppose to index

9e02f6f07f1564be215a9838ff9526dd4dc12b2e authored almost 3 years ago
Migrate to rely on globalThis to access chrome

- This fixes issues when running headless environment where there is no extension features.

bab3a79715812fdcf885bd09639332ac960c4ebb authored almost 3 years ago
Try without the puppeteer

248571c86a2370ea0b3273003921159d6847f912 authored almost 3 years ago
Fix browser config for test run

989b7b5d45bab424e0887c214d297ead2bcbeeb5 authored almost 3 years ago
Attempt at getting karma chrome launcher working on GitHub

315fc08795cbbbe3f4af119f8330e4341ec815b3 authored almost 3 years ago
Add test for Network Status

Related to #73

760b0a802eab26a89b7780eca78971a1bb32d5ba authored almost 3 years ago
Add a basic FeatureService test

68f036b1628aa91c1560b5aad7385cd1bfa25d82 authored almost 3 years ago
Add more configuration for test runs

24c05cafc35c35eee4432165f31af59e357cabd4 authored almost 3 years ago
Run test on CI

29de74cd6e727dcd0911455567b57e262c647c0b authored almost 3 years ago
Setup correct webpack for testing

a57b510adfe2dac1411d4f9b217b740b7384312b authored almost 3 years ago
Set the correct module for testing

77a94eed9b795a8f7f8701f8c3d8edae8b3fe1d5 authored almost 3 years ago
Add import for Translation in Testbed

17b494fdcc74907480698dd09753c55be09f3525 authored almost 3 years ago
Add conditional check for "chrome" on CommunicationService

15e001e9cac0d0b201425577dc6b87ffcb678a23 authored almost 3 years ago
Add chrome types for tsconfig.spec.json

b49138b09c37665821f57507c2294f16e64731e8 authored almost 3 years ago
Update changelog and version

9cec61f7f55d67fd7286a1c052e4b852774ceb38 authored almost 3 years ago
Fix issue with accounts not having identifier

- This require a full reset of the state.
- Remove the extension and install new version.
- Adds...

5a9e3cfe03e26bdf1ac45619592b5da6e648acbd authored almost 3 years ago
Make the explorer link dependent on instance of extension

45888335595c7ff65ac095d52ecb1646ff405c20 authored almost 3 years ago
Update changelog and version

01d1624139a9d50cd2a758e82d83c80e07236da0 authored almost 3 years ago
Fixing the network configuration for test networks

283ac79e8152638907466d43776a23934fcb9544 authored almost 3 years ago
Add handling of indexer online but node is offline

0dacaa68cb52ab865f9b175443e4eb1fa2fd683a authored almost 3 years ago
Add the network status check to watch indexer also

64019916ebd2b757c6fe7ce62c1877e8fd59c3cf authored almost 3 years ago
Update the changelog and version

e759009749ade56ef823e9aa3c445facd1064b85 authored almost 3 years ago
Skip querying the indexer if the status is not online

84b90d40af61010a3dec0a084a6a81e45524e747 authored almost 3 years ago
Add some improved error handling and logging for different network status

35caf662771c428d1e11fde34168c9acf9fd02bf authored almost 3 years ago
Add syncing status (behind tip) to the network status indicator

- Currently configured to show "syncing" if more than 10 blocks behind.

d7d00f67264e39b0a17e9091d3894d835249b5ae authored almost 3 years ago
Introduce a new 'ui-activated' event used to get additional state information

d17bc290c091e693b38f17918501caab2e1408f3 authored almost 3 years ago
Improve the networks status code

e00fa88d72aed66963bc01a607b00375cab4bc20 authored almost 3 years ago